患有全身性犬瘟热病毒感染的幼犬的干骺端骨病变

Metaphyseal bone lesions in young dogs with systemic canine distemper virus infection.

作者信息

Baumgärtner W, Boyce R W, Alldinger S, Axthelm M K, Weisbrode S E, Krakowka S, Gaedke K

机构信息

Institut für Veterinär-Pathologie, Justus-Liebig-Universität Giessen, Germany.

出版信息

Vet Microbiol. 1995 May;44(2-4):201-9. doi: 10.1016/0378-1135(95)00013-z.

DOI:10.1016/0378-1135(95)00013-z
PMID:8588314
Abstract

Bone lesions, restricted to the metaphyses of long bones, were observed in young dogs with systemic distemper following experimental and spontaneous infection. Canine distemper virus (CDV) antigen was found immunocytochemically in hematopoietic marrow cells, osteoclasts, osteoblasts and rarely in osteocytes. In experimentally infected dogs, viral antigen was demonstrated in the metaphysis between 5 and 36 days after infection. Associated lesions, characterized by necrosis of osteoclasts, persistence of primary spongiosa and atrophy and necrosis of osteoblasts and marrow cells, were mild and most prominent between 8 and 32 days postinfection. Metaphyseal osteosclerosis (MO) of the long bones, varying from mild to severe, was observed macroscopically in 8 (19%) out of 42 dogs with spontaneous distemper. Affected animals were between 3 and 6 months of age and belonged mainly to the large breeds. In these animals, MO was characterized histologically by persistence of primary spongiosa, loss of bone marrow cells and necrosis of osteoclasts and bone marrow cells varying from mild to severe. Summarized, CDV-associated bone lesions were only transient and there were no indications of viral persistence in bones of dogs experimentally infected with CDV. Although no clinical signs related to the bones were observed, the present study reveals that infection of metaphyseal bone cells is common in young dogs with systemic distemper and occurrence of viral antigen in these cells results in defects in bone modelling.

摘要

在实验性感染和自然感染犬瘟热的幼犬中,观察到骨病变局限于长骨的干骺端。通过免疫细胞化学方法在造血骨髓细胞、破骨细胞、成骨细胞中发现了犬瘟热病毒(CDV)抗原,在骨细胞中很少发现。在实验感染的犬中,感染后5至36天在干骺端检测到病毒抗原。相关病变的特征为破骨细胞坏死、初级骨小梁持续存在以及成骨细胞和骨髓细胞萎缩和坏死,病变较轻,在感染后8至32天最为明显。在42只自然感染犬瘟热的犬中,有8只(19%)在宏观上观察到长骨干骺端骨硬化(MO),程度从轻度到重度不等。受影响的动物年龄在3至6个月之间,主要为大型犬种。在这些动物中,MO的组织学特征为初级骨小梁持续存在、骨髓细胞减少以及破骨细胞和骨髓细胞坏死,程度从轻度到重度不等。总之,与CDV相关的骨病变只是暂时的,在实验感染CDV的犬的骨骼中没有病毒持续存在的迹象。尽管未观察到与骨骼相关的临床症状,但本研究表明,在全身性犬瘟热的幼犬中,干骺端骨细胞感染很常见,这些细胞中病毒抗原的出现导致骨建模缺陷。
